Career Services Manager & Career Coach, MHA
Job Summary
The David Eccles School of Business seeks a dynamic and experienced Career Advancement Manager & Coach to serve students in the Master of Healthcare Administration (MHA) program. This individual will play a central role in shaping the professional success and industry engagement of MHA students, while contributing to the program's overall strategic direction and reputation.
The ideal candidate has a healthcare background and a deep understanding of healthcare organizations, talent development, and industry dynamics—coupled with expertise in career coaching, relationship management, and program leadership. They will partner with faculty, alumni, employers, and national organizations to elevate the MHA program's visibility and outcomes, ensuring students are well-positioned for impactful careers in healthcare leadership. This role also includes employer relations, professional development programming, case competition management, and alumni engagement.
Responsibilities
Career Coaching & Student Development
- Provide one-on-one and group career coaching to MHA students, focusing on job search strategy, personal branding, interviewing, networking, and offer negotiation.
- Guide students in career pivots and leadership advancement within healthcare organizations.
- Develop and deliver workshops on professional skills, executive presence, and healthcare-specific career pathways.
- Monitor career outcomes, collect student feedback, and implement continuous improvements in coaching and programming.
Employer & Alumni Engagement
- Build, strengthen, and maintain relationships with healthcare organizations, employers, and alumni to expand internship and full-time employment opportunities.
- Lead and attend industry networking events, site visits, and employer panels to connect students with real-world opportunities.
- Manage alumni engagement efforts that encourage mentorship, career panels, and professional networking within the MHA community.
Career Programming & Events
- Support all aspects of MHA case competitions, including team formation, coaching logistics, faculty coordination, and national competition participation.
- Plan and execute events that enhance student professional growth, such as career fairs and networking receptions.
- Collaborate across the Eccles School's Graduate Career Management Center to align employer outreach and recruiting initiatives.
Program Collaboration
- Contribute to the MHA program's strategic goals, accreditation compliance (CAHME), and continuous improvement initiatives.
- Take ownership of emerging projects or priorities as assigned, serving as a flexible and collaborative member of the MHA team.
- Partner with staff to integrate career readiness into the academic experience and ensure alignment with healthcare industry trends.
